Shopify App 审核是应用上线前的关键环节,审核标准严格且细节要求高,本文结合开发者常见问题和官方指南,总结审核经验与技巧,帮助你高效通过审核,避免反复修改。
Shopify 审核核心标准
Shopify 审核重点关注 功能完整性、用户体验、安全合规、开发者诚信 四大维度,具体包括:
- 功能可用性:应用能正常安装、运行、卸载,无致命 bug。
- 用户体验(UX):界面简洁、操作流畅,无诱导性设计或冗余步骤。
- 数据安全:用户数据处理合规(如 GDPR/CCPA),权限申请合理。
- 开发者规范:无侵权、误导性描述,不滥用 Shopify 资源(如 API 调用限制)。
审核前必做自查清单
功能完整性检查
-
核心功能可用:确保应用核心功能(如订单同步、营销工具)在测试店铺中 100% 正常运行,避免“演示模式”或“功能未完成”状态。
- ✅ 测试场景:安装流程、权限授权、关键操作(如创建订单、修改产品)、错误提示(如网络异常时的友好提示)。
- ❌ 常见问题:依赖第三方服务但未处理接口失败情况,导致功能中断。
-
卸载与数据清理:卸载应用后,需清除店铺中与应用相关的残留数据(如 metafields、webhooks),避免影响商家店铺性能。
用户体验(UX)优化
- 界面简洁直观:
- 避免复杂的设置流程,首次使用时提供引导(如新手教程)。
- 按钮、表单等交互元素清晰,无错别字或语法错误(英文界面需专业校对)。
- 加载速度:页面加载时间控制在 3 秒内,避免过度使用大型 JS 库或未优化的图片。
- 错误处理:所有操作(如 API 调用失败、权限不足)需返回明确错误信息,引导用户解决(例:“请开启 Shopify 订单编辑权限”)。
安全与合规必备项
-
权限申请最小化:仅申请必要的 API 权限(参考 Shopify 权限列表),避免过度授权。
- ❌ 错误示例:仅需读取产品数据却申请
write_products权限,审核会要求缩减权限。 - ✅ 正确做法:明确权限用途,并在应用描述中说明(如“申请
read_orders权限用于同步订单数据”)。
- ❌ 错误示例:仅需读取产品数据却申请
-
数据隐私合规:
- 提供 隐私政策(必须公开可访问,说明数据收集、使用、存储方式)。
- 若涉及欧盟用户,需符合 GDPR(如提供数据导出/删除功能)。
- 禁止收集敏感信息(如信用卡号、密码),除非通过 Shopify 官方支付接口(如 Shopify Payments)。
-
防欺诈与滥用:
- 限制 API 调用频率,避免触发 Shopify 限流机制。
- 禁止自动创建测试订单、虚假评价,或诱导商家进行违规操作(如刷单)。
应用信息准确性
- 应用描述与实际功能一致:截图、描述需真实反映功能,避免“免费”“最佳”等夸大词汇(Shopify 禁止误导性宣传)。
示例:若应用仅支持美国物流,需在描述中明确标注“仅支持美国地区”。
- 联系信息有效:开发者邮箱、网址需可正常联系,避免使用个人邮箱(如 gmail.com,建议用企业域名邮箱)。
常见被拒原因及解决方案
功能缺陷(占比最高)
- 问题:安装后白屏、关键按钮无响应、API 调用失败未提示。
- 解决:
- 使用 Shopify 测试店铺 完整模拟商家操作流程。
- 检查日志:确保 API 错误(如 403/429)有友好提示,而非直接崩溃。
权限过度申请
- 问题:申请与功能无关的权限(如仅展示数据却申请
write_orders)。 - 解决:
- 参考 权限最小化原则,仅保留核心权限。
- 在审核备注中说明权限用途(如“
read_customers用于匹配会员等级”)。
隐私政策缺失或不完整
- 问题:未提供隐私政策,或未说明数据存储位置、第三方共享情况。
- 解决:
- 使用工具生成合规模板(如 Shopify 隐私政策生成器)。
- 明确说明:数据是否跨境传输、存储期限、商家如何删除数据。
用户体验差
- 问题:界面混乱、无引导说明、强制跳转外部链接。
- 解决:
- 首次打开应用时提供 功能引导弹窗,说明核心操作步骤。
- 外部链接需标注跳转提示(如“即将离开 Shopify 管理后台”)。
审核流程与沟通技巧
审核流程
- 提交前:在 Partner Dashboard 确保“App Listing”信息完整(截图、描述、隐私政策链接等)。
- 审核周期:常规审核 5-7 个工作日,加急审核需联系 Shopify 支持(需特殊理由)。
- 结果通知:通过邮件告知,被拒会附具体原因(如“权限过度申请”“功能未完成”)。
被拒后如何高效修改?
- 精准定位问题:根据审核反馈中的关键词(如“缺少取消订阅流程”),优先修复核心问题。
- 提交备注说明:重新提交时,在“Notes to Reviewer”中详细说明修改点(例:“已移除
write_inventory权限,仅保留read_inventory”)。 - 避免重复被拒:修改后用测试店铺二次验证,确保所有问题一次性解决。
优化审核时间的实用技巧
-
提前测试关键场景:
- 测试不同 Shopify 版本(如 Basic/Advanced)和浏览器(Chrome/Safari)兼容性。
- 模拟商家无技术背景的操作(如误填数据时的容错处理)。
-
参考优质应用案例:
分析同类热门应用(如 Klaviyo、Oberlo)的界面设计和权限申请范围,对标行业标准。
-
利用官方资源:
- 仔细阅读 Shopify App 审核指南,重点关注“Rejection Reasons”章节。
- 加入 Shopify 开发者论坛,搜索同类问题的解决方案。
上线后注意事项
- 监控应用稳定性:上线后 24 小时内关注错误日志(如通过 Sentry),避免因突发流量导致崩溃。
- 收集用户反馈:通过应用内弹窗或邮件调研商家体验,及时迭代功能(低评分会影响后续推荐)。
- 合规更新:若涉及数据政策变更(如 GDPR 新规),需同步更新隐私政策并重新通过审核。
Shopify 审核的核心是 “以商家体验为中心”,确保应用安全、可用、合规,通过提前自查功能、优化权限申请、完善隐私政策,可大幅提高审核通过率,若被拒,耐心分析反馈并针对性修改,1-2 轮即可通过。
祝你的应用顺利上线,为 Shopify 商家创造价值! 🚀
官方资源推荐:






网友评论